.SH "NAME"
.HP
gcloud run jobs get\-iam\-policy \- get the IAM policy for a Cloud Run job
.SH "SYNOPSIS"
.HP
\f5gcloud run jobs get\-iam\-policy\fR \fIJOB\fR [\fB\-\-region\fR=\fIREGION\fR] [\fB\-\-filter\fR=\fIEXPRESSION\fR] [\fB\-\-limit\fR=\fILIMIT\fR] [\fB\-\-page\-size\fR=\fIPAGE_SIZE\fR] [\fB\-\-sort\-by\fR=[\fIFIELD\fR,...]] [\fIGCLOUD_WIDE_FLAG\ ...\fR]
.SH "DESCRIPTION"
This command gets the IAM policy for a job. If formatted as JSON, the output can
be edited and used as a policy file for \fBset\-iam\-policy\fR. The output
includes an "etag" field identifying the version emitted and allowing detection
of concurrent policy updates; see $ gcloud alpha run registries set\-iam\-policy
for additional details.
.SH "EXAMPLES"
To print the IAM policy for a given job, run:
.RS 2m
$ gcloud run jobs get\-iam\-policy \-\-region=us\-central1 my\-job
.RE

.SH "LIST COMMAND FLAGS"
.RS 2m
.TP 2m
\fB\-\-filter\fR=\fIEXPRESSION\fR
Apply a Boolean filter \fIEXPRESSION\fR to each resource item to be listed. If
the expression evaluates \f5True\fR, then that item is listed. For more details
and examples of filter expressions, run $ gcloud topic filters. This flag
interacts with other flags that are applied in this order: \fB\-\-flatten\fR,
\fB\-\-sort\-by\fR, \fB\-\-filter\fR, \fB\-\-limit\fR.
.TP 2m
\fB\-\-limit\fR=\fILIMIT\fR
Maximum number of resources to list. The default is \fBunlimited\fR. This flag
interacts with other flags that are applied in this order: \fB\-\-flatten\fR,
\fB\-\-sort\-by\fR, \fB\-\-filter\fR, \fB\-\-limit\fR.
.TP 2m
\fB\-\-page\-size\fR=\fIPAGE_SIZE\fR
Some services group resource list output into pages. This flag specifies the
maximum number of resources per page. The default is determined by the service
if it supports paging, otherwise it is \fBunlimited\fR (no paging). Paging may
be applied before or after \fB\-\-filter\fR and \fB\-\-limit\fR depending on the
service.
.TP 2m
\fB\-\-sort\-by\fR=[\fIFIELD\fR,...]
Comma\-separated list of resource field key names to sort by. The default order
is ascending. Prefix a field with ``~'' for descending order on that field. This
flag interacts with other flags that are applied in this order:
\fB\-\-flatten\fR, \fB\-\-sort\-by\fR, \fB\-\-filter\fR, \fB\-\-limit\fR.
